package aws
|
||
|
|
||
|
import (
|
||
|
"log"
|
||
|
"regexp"
|
||
|
|
||
|
"github.com/aws/aws-sdk-go/aws"
|
||
|
"github.com/aws/aws-sdk-go/service/inspector"
|
||
|
)
|
||
|
|
||
|
// diffTags takes our tags locally and the ones remotely and returns
|
||
|
// the set of tags that must be created, and the set of tags that must
|
||
|
// be destroyed.
|
||
|
func diffTagsInspector(oldTags, newTags []*inspector.ResourceGroupTag) ([]*inspector.ResourceGroupTag, []*inspector.ResourceGroupTag) {
|
||
|
// First, we're creating everything we have
|
||
|
create := make(map[string]interface{})
|
||
|
for _, t := range newTags {
|
||
|
create[*t.Key] = *t.Value
|
||
|
}
|
||
|
|
||
|
// Build the list of what to remove
|
||
|
var remove []*inspector.ResourceGroupTag
|
||
|
for _, t := range oldTags {
|
||
|
old, ok := create[*t.Key]
|
||
|
if !ok || old != *t.Value {
|
||
|
// Delete it!
|
||
|
remove = append(remove, t)
|
||
|
}
|
||
|
}
|
||
|
|
||
|
return tagsFromMapInspector(create), remove
|
||
|
}
|
||
|
|
||
|
// tagsFromMap returns the tags for the given map of data.
|
||
|
func tagsFromMapInspector(m map[string]interface{}) []*inspector.ResourceGroupTag {
|
||
|
var result []*inspector.ResourceGroupTag
|
||
|
for k, v := range m {
|
||
|
t := &inspector.ResourceGroupTag{
|
||
|
Key: aws.String(k),
|
||
|
Value: aws.String(v.(string)),
|
||
|
}
|
||
|
if !tagIgnoredInspector(t) {
|
||
|
result = append(result, t)
|
||
|
}
|
||
|
}
|
||
|
|
||
|
return result
|
||
|
}
|
||
|
|
||
|
// tagsToMap turns the list of tags into a map.
|
||
|
func tagsToMapInspector(ts []*inspector.ResourceGroupTag) map[string]string {
|
||
|
result := make(map[string]string)
|
||
|
for _, t := range ts {
|
||
|
if !tagIgnoredInspector(t) {
|
||
|
result[*t.Key] = *t.Value
|
||
|
}
|
||
|
}
|
||
|
|
||
|
return result
|
||
|
}
|
||
|
|
||
|
// compare a tag against a list of strings and checks if it should
|
||
|
// be ignored or not
|
||
|
func tagIgnoredInspector(t *inspector.ResourceGroupTag) bool {
|
||
|
filter := []string{"^aws:*"}
|
||
|
for _, v := range filter {
|
||
|
log.Printf("[DEBUG] Matching %v with %v\n", v, *t.Key)
|
||
|
if r, _ := regexp.MatchString(v, *t.Key); r == true {
|
||
|
log.Printf("[DEBUG] Found AWS specific tag %s (val: %s), ignoring.\n", *t.Key, *t.Value)
|
||
|
return true
|
||
|
}
|
||
|
}
|
||
|
return false
|
||
|
}
